Basically when I click "Search Foreign Aid" on a nation the resulting screen showed no aid.


I was searching my members aid to arrange tech deals, when i clicked "Search Foreign Aid" I was taken to the Login screen since I haven't done anything for 10 mins. I just click sign in and it took me to that members Foreign Aid screen as linked before. I got him 5 deals then the buyers told me he only has 1 slot open.

So that link is showing false info for members when they sign in to view aid.

To fix it I had to go back to the nation screen and go into the Search Foreign Aid again. Im using Google Chrome and the bug works with mozilla.

This is because of how the URL transforms during a "logged out" to "logged in" transition.

[code]Logged in: http://www.cybernations.net/search_aid.asp?search=396411&Extended=1
"During" login: http://www.cybernations.net/login.asp?accessdenied=%2Fsearch_aid.asp%3Fsearch%3D396411%26amp%3BExtended%3D1
Logged out-logged in: http://www.cybernations.net/search_aid.asp?search=396411&Extended=1[/code]

Notice the &? & is the HTML code for ampersand (&).
In the During login, its %26amp%3B -- %26 is &, so what happens is the & is turned into &, and the amp; that was already there is kept.

This produces the result you see.

Edit: A user-side work-around is to always click wars/aid a *second* time if you see none.

Edited by Sakura
